What We Like
+Compact and lightweight at 565g despite f/2.8 constant aperture
+Sharp image quality across entire focal range with excellent chromatic aberration control
+Fast and precise VXD autofocus with excellent subject tracking and quiet operation
+Unique 35-100mm focal length optimized for portrait, event, and travel photography
+Close minimum focus distance of 0.22m (35mm) with 1:3.3 magnification for creative tabletop shots
+USB-C port with Tamron Lens Utility software for customizable AF and control functions
Worth Knowing
Limited wide-angle coverage at 35mm, not suitable as primary landscape lens
Not internally focusing; extends approximately 2cm at full zoom
No built-in image stabilization; relies on camera IBIS
Some reported softness at 100mm f/2.8 on certain samples (possible variation)

The Tamron 35-100mm F/2.8 Di III VXD is an outstanding people and general-purpose lens, with highlights including sharp image quality, a wide f/2.8 aperture, high-performing VXD linear AF, and a high-quality, compact, and lightweight design. Priced at $900 USD and weighing just 565g, this lens represents a more moderate alternative to larger and more expensive fast zooms. At its introduction, the Tamron 35-100mm F/2.8 Di III VXD Lens is the only 35-100mm full-frame lens, making this unique focal length range ideal for portrait photographers seeking portability.
